<center dir="cx2"></center><code dropzone="jw5"></code><b lang="14i"></b><noscript dropzone="m6y"></noscript>

使用 TP 创建离线钱包:从安全构建到高级支付与动态验证的综合分析

引言

本文围绕使用 TP 创建离线钱包(air‑gapped wallet)展开详细分析,覆盖从密钥产生与隔离流程,到高级支付方案、合约监控、不可篡改审计与动态验证机制,并给出专业评估与技术转型建议。

1. 离线钱包的核心构建要点

- 环境隔离:在与互联网物理隔离的设备上生成私钥或助记词,使用可信的操作系统快照或只读映像启动。推荐使用一次性干净系统和受信任的硬件(例如老旧但完整刷新的笔记本或专用嵌入式设备)。

- 随机性与种子管理:采用经过审计的开源 RNG,记录熵来源与校验步骤。生成助记词后,立即离线备份到多份金属或纸介质,分散存放并加密少数索引信息。

- 签名路径:构建明确的交易签名流程,例如用 PSBT(部分签名比特币交易)或离线签名 JSON 格式,支持 QR/二维码或离线 USB 介质传输,避免明文私钥通过网络暴露。

2. 高级支付方案

- 多重签名(Multisig)与门限签名(M-of-N):在 TP 离线钱包中集成多重签名策略,将签名权分散到多台离线设备或不同地理位置,降低单点被攻破风险。

- 门限密码学(MPC):当硬件或组织不希望集中管理私钥时,可采用 MPC 协议实现分布式签名,兼顾可用性与安全性,适合机构级支付流程。

- 支付通道与批量交易:对高频小额支付使用链下通道或批量打包策略,减少链上费用并提高吞吐,同时离线钱包负责最终结算签名。

- HTLC 与原子交换:在跨链或条件支付场景,离线钱包应能生成含哈希时间锁合约的交易预构造包并在安全环境中签名。

3. 合约监控与事件响应

- 实时与离线结合:线上节点与索引器持续监听链上合约事件,检测异常调用、资金流向或授权变更,触发告警并记录事件摘要到不可篡改日志。

- 自动化审计链路:将重要事件打包成摘要并周期性写入区块链(或使用透明日志服务),与离线钱包的签名记录关联,便于事后追溯。

- 多层告警策略:分等级告警(信息、警告、紧急),并定义离线签名的紧急流程,比如冷存储重构、多方批准的应急解冻。

4. 不可篡改与审计保障

- 不可篡改日志:采用区块链或透明日志以时间戳方式固定关键操作摘要(如密钥生成证明、交易签名记录、策略变更),确保审计链的防篡改性。

- 证明链条:结合硬件安全模块(HSM)或可信执行环境(TEE)输出的签名证据,将操作证据与链上记录绑定。

5. 动态验证机制

- 分层验证:在签名前后分别校验交易构造的正确性、合约调用参数和接收方地址,使用多方交叉比对减少错误或被劫持的风险。

- 零知识与证明:对隐私或合规敏感操作,可采用零知识证明验证特定属性(如余额合规性、授权合法性)而不泄露细节。

- 行为分析与风控:结合链上分析与机器学习模型实时评估交易异常性,作为动态风控的一部分,决定是否进入人工核验或触发多重确认。

6. 专业观点报告(要点)

- 风险矩阵:区分技术风险(私钥泄露、签名篡改)、操作风险(助记词管理、流程失误)与合规风险(KYC/AML、跨境监管)。

- 建议:采用多重签名与门限签名结合、定期第三方审计、引入透明日志与链上摘要存证、制定应急治理与角色分离策略。

7. 创新科技转型路径

- 从单一冷钱包向可组合的安全服务转型:集成 MPC、TEE、去中心化身份(DID)、可验证计算(ZK)等新技术,构建模块化安全框架。

- 开放式 SDK 与自动化运维:提供经过审计的离线签名 SDK,支持自动化生成签名包与验证工具,降低企业接入门槛。

结论与行动项

构建 TP 离线钱包不仅是技术实现,更需制度与流程保障;通过多重签名、门限签名、不可篡改日志与动态验证,能显著提升安全性与合规性。建议先在测试网或沙箱环境验证完整签名与监控链路,逐步引入 MPC 与零知识组件,并保持第三方安全审计与应急演练频率。

作者:林墨发布时间:2026-01-29 01:29:59

评论

CryptoTiger

文章逻辑清晰,特别赞同多重签名与MPC并行的建议,实操性很强。

小舟

关于不可篡改日志那一节很实用,想知道推荐哪些透明日志服务?

SatoshiFan

希望能出个离线签名与PSBT的实战示例,方便工程落地。

黎明

动态验证与风控结合的思路很前沿,尤其是把ML用于链上异常检测。

AnnaW

专业且务实,建议补充不同合规区(如欧盟、美国)对离线钱包的合规差异。

相关阅读